Prostitution Sweep – 25 Johns Charged

(Ottawa) — In an ongoing effort to deal with community identified prostitution and prostitution related problems, the Ottawa Police Service conducted a two-day prostitution John sweep in Vanier on August 21 and 22, 2013.

A total of 25 John/Males arrests were made. Twenty-two of the males qualified for the Pre-charge Diversion Program, which includes attending “John” School. “John School” is a project that applies a restorative justice approach to the effects of prostitution within our communities and focuses on education.

The remaining three were charged with a variety of offenses including communicating for the purpose of prostitution, mischief, under the Controlled Drugs and Substances Act. A total of seven criminal charges were laid.

The Ottawa Police Service conducts enforcement in response to community complaints as one of their strategies to prostitution related issues.
